DPU:
_ The Department of Public Utilities (DPU) is the state agency responsible for overseeing investor-owned electric power, natural gas, and water companies in Massachusetts. It regulates the safety of bus companies, moving companies, transportation network companies, and oversees the safety of natural gas pipelines and the MBTA. _
Job Description:
_ This internship is an excellent opportunity to experience various aspects of communications planning (including managing press inquiries) at a government agency. The work of the social media and communications Intern will help to inform DPU staff about key ongoing efforts of the Department, raise awareness about the work of DPU to the public, and maintain records of communications outreach and media requests. Projects include planning, writing, and managing social media content; capturing data to use in public reports; managing graphic and video design campaigns; assisting with press events; and more. _
Job Duties:
_
  • Assist with distributing daily news clips.
  • Assist in the development of social media content and graphics that are engaging and informative.
  • Monitor all social media platforms for trending news, ideas, and feedback.
  • Assist in implementing plans to increase public awareness and engagement on the work of the Department.
  • Assist in the development of DPU's internal newsletter.
  • Assist in drafting media advisories, press releases and other related content.
  • Maintain records and logs of media coverage and requests, as well as outreach activities of the office.
  • Assist in the development of collateral materials.
  • Take photos and/or video of events and meetings.
  • Assist in the development of content for DPU's website.
  • Assist the Director of Communications on other activities and duties as assigned.
